<description>&#60;p&#62;I use them pretty regularly.  They're flash-frozen at the peak of their ripe-ness, so they still contain all the good nutrients, and as far as I'm concerned, they taste pretty much the same.  Sometimes I don't get around to using fresh veggies until they're past their prime, so they've either lost a lot of their nutrients or taste, or I have to throw them out.
